Subject: [PATCH AUTOSEL 5.4 55/79] net/mlx5: Modify LSB bitmask in temperature event to include only the first bit

In the sensor_count field of the MTEWE register, bits 1-62 are
supported only for unmanaged switches, not for NICs, and bit 63
is reserved for internal use.

To prevent confusing output that may include set bits that are
not relevant to NIC sensors, we update the bitmask to retain only
the first bit, which corresponds to the sensor ASIC.

diff --git a/drivers/net/ethernet/mellanox/mlx5/core/events.c b/drivers/net/ethernet/mellanox/mlx5/core/events.c
index 3ce17c3d7a001..9d7b0a4cc48a9 100644
--- a/drivers/net/ethernet/mellanox/mlx5/core/events.c
+++ b/drivers/net/ethernet/mellanox/mlx5/core/events.c
@@ -156,6 +156,10 @@ static int temp_warn(struct notifier_block *nb, unsigned long type, void *data)
 	u64 value_msb;
 
 	value_lsb = be64_to_cpu(eqe->data.temp_warning.sensor_warning_lsb);
+	/* bit 1-63 are not supported for NICs,
+	 * hence read only bit 0 (asic) from lsb.
+	 */
+	value_lsb &= 0x1;
 	value_msb = be64_to_cpu(eqe->data.temp_warning.sensor_warning_msb);
 
 	mlx5_core_warn(events->dev,
